As far as games...maybe a doggy "easter egg hunt" Bake treats shaped like eggs or bones....hide them and let the doggies find them! It would be fun and a treat to them instantly! |
Some things we've done at doggie "pawties": "leave it" competition. Dogs and owners sit in a big circle. Paper plate is placed infront of each dog. Then the person running the show places food on each plate (something yummy), owner is allowed to give commands such as "leave it" or whatever works but cannot physically intervene. Food keeps being added (make it interesting)...last dog to eat wins. "Simon Says" Caller names a "trick", sit, down, rollover, etc... that dogs in group know. Owner gives command to their dog. "musical chairs" place hulahoops on the floor in a large circle. play music. owners walk dogs around outside of hoops (one less hoop than dog). when the music starts owners try to get their dog to sit inside a hoop (only one dog per hoop). Once all hoops are filled, the dog who is left over is out. "dog kissing contest" - do I really need to elaborate? "longest tail, shortest tail, tallest, whitest, biggest ears" etc...use your imagination and give out awards making sure everyone wins. Also, if it's going to be hot, it's nice to have some clean baby pools sitting around outside during outdoor events. |

I helped launch a dog show as part of our work's annual picnic a few years ago. I made little packs of doggie treats and a little toy for every entrant. As prizes, I had things like toy sets, toys, and PetSmart gift certificates. We also did a "Stupid Pet Tricks" competition. The goofier it was, the higher up it was in the rankings.:D |
For prizes, you could do themed baskets: A basket w/ bath shampoo/conditioner and supplies A treat basket A toy basket A travel themed basket |
